摘要 | This paper investigates the crashworthiness characteristics of spherical-roof contoured-core sandwich panels under out-of-plane quasi-static loading. Two types of composite materials were chosen to fabricate the novel core structure: self-reinforced polypropylene (SRPP) and carbon fiber-reinforced plastic (CFRP) materials. The hot compression molding method was used to prepare the CFRP and SRPP cores bonded with two CFRP skins as sandwich structures. It was exhibited that the nominal stress of the sandwich structure with CFRP core reached the maximum stress of 0.15 MPa, and the nominal maximum stress of the SRPP core of the sandwich panel was 0.04 MPa. Moreover, it was shown that the sandwich structure with CFRP core was 3.50 and 2.18 times more than the SRPP core on compressive strength and stiffness. Sandwich panel with CFRP core had an average value of 65.64 J and 1.08 kJ/kg on energy absorption (EA) and specific energy absorption (SEA) of crashworthiness indicators, which were 4.34 and 4.10 times higher than the SRPP core. It was summarized that the CFRP core provided better crashworthiness characteristics than the SRPP core on the sandwich structure. In addition, the failure behavior of the sandwich structure with CFRP core was observed fiber fracture, delamination, and debonding between the core and two skins. Sandwich structure with SRPP core was shown the buckling and debonding between the core and two skins. |
